Northrop Grumman Mission Systems is seeking a Sr. Principal Mechanical Microelectronic Packaging Engineer to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als. The Secure Processing organization, part of Northrop Grumman Mission Systems, is searching for Mechanical Microelectronic Packaging Design engineers in support of rapid growth in the Secure Processing organization. You will have the opportunity to be part of an expanding team of dedicated engineers directly supporting the engineering development of innovative Secure Processing solutions for a variety of end user applications. This position will be located onsite in Linthicum, Maryland.
As an integral part of the Secure Processing Solutions team within the Airborne Multifunction Sensor Engineering and Sciences organization, you will be responsible for the design and development of cutting-edge Secure Processing hardware. You'll support multiple projects spanning the product lifecycle, from R&D to full-rate production.
Roles and Responsibilities include:
- Design, prototyping and production support of state-of-the-art RF, digital, and mixed signal multi-chip modules (MCMs), Printed Wiring Boards (PWBs), and Circuit Card Assemblies (CCAs) using various substrate materials and chip-scale packaging technologies
- Collaboration within a cross-functional Integrated Product Team (IPT); effective and timely communication with peers in adjacent functions, including electrical design, systems engineering, thermal analysis, structural analysis, drafting, supply chain management and manufacturing.
- Organizing and prioritizing tasks in order to accomplish project milestones within schedule and budgetary constraints.
- Providing technical leadership and mentoring to less experienced personnel.
Basic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ree with 8 years of experience, a Master’s degree with 6 years of experience or a PhD with 4 years of experience in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Computer Science, or related technical fields.
- U.S Citizenship with the ability to obtain/maintain an active DoD Secret Clearance
- Ability to qualify for special program access (SAP/SAR)
- Experience with microelectronic packaging design, including chip-scale packaging technologies and substrate\PWB layout
- Working knowledge of materials, specifications, manufacturing processes and design tools utilized for multi-chip modules, PWBs and CCAs
- Proficient with AutoCAD
- Familiarity with NX or other 3D modeling software
